thestealth -> RE: Is a Stealth right for me? (5/8/2008 1:37:24 PM)

If they are properly maintained, they are as reliable as any other old(er) used car.  From the sound of things, it being an auction car, you won't know the maintenance history of it.  You should figure in a 120k service, which will run you about $1500 for parts/labor.  They handle on snow as well as any other FWD car (ES and RT), depending upon your tires of course.  Read through the buyers guide stickied at the top of the forum for common problems.
